    Default changing descr_sounds_units_anims

    Does anyone know how to change the sounds in descr_sounds_units_anims.txt?

    I checked over at twc and the wiki and there are no tutorials on this.

    I've figured out other sound changes, but whenever I put something new into units_anims, the game won't recognize the changes and uses the old set. Can I add in new 'event ANIM_...' to it?
    Where do these get referenced from?

    Any help or guidance in the right direction would be appreciated.

    You can only change it if you have access to the .evt files in an unpacked animation. I don't think you can do that for the other units. (Or rather I asked before and Wles thought you couldn't https://forums.totalwar.org/vb/showp...99&postcount=8 - he's done a lot on animations so is likely to be right)
